Asociativa de contenedores en C ++ Simplificado - Parte 1 División 1 Introducción Esta es la primera parte de mi serie, asociativa de contenedores en C ++ simplificado. Un contenedor es un objeto instanciado, que tiene una lista (array) como su característica fundamental. A diferencia de una lista de arreglo, un contenedor puede crecer o disminuir de tamaño (longitud). Diferentes contenedores tienen diferentes propiedades y métodos. En esta parte de la serie, les presento lo que se llama el contenedor mapa asociativo.
Un contenedor asociativo utiliza una plantilla para sus elementos. Hay dos tipos de clases de contenedores, llamados Secuencias y asociativa Containers. Esta serie trata sobre asociativas Contenedores. He escrito una serie diferente para Secuencia Contenedores, lo que le sugiero que lea antes de leer esto. Esta serie se divide en divisiones. Una división tiene al menos una parte. La primera división se refiere el contenedor mapa asociativo. Nota: Si no puede ver el código o si cree que falta algo (enlace roto, la imagen ausente), simplemente en contacto conmigo en [email protected].
Es decir, en contacto conmigo para el más mínimo problema que tenga acerca de lo que está leyendo. Instalación estándar de C ++ Biblioteca C ++ viene con una biblioteca que tiene características importantes y comunes (segmentos de código ya hechos) que se puede utilizar, sin necesidad de escribir código para las características. Esta biblioteca se llama la biblioteca estándar. La biblioteca está dividido en categorías. Estas categorías todavía se denominan bibliotecas. Las categorías se dividen en componentes. Los componentes se dividen en entidades.
Las entidades son cosas básicas como los tipos de datos y funciones. Hay muchos archivos de cabecera para la biblioteca estándar. Para acceder a una función (entidad) a través de un archivo de encabezado. Con una instalación típica de C ++, usted no necesita saber dónde (directorio) de la biblioteca estándar o bibliotecas estándar se mantienen; usted no necesita saber siquiera dónde se guardan los archivos de cabecera para la biblioteca estándar. Con mi instalación (MinGW), todo lo que necesitas saber es el nombre de los archivos de cabecera.
Para utilizar los archivos de cabecera, sólo tiene que incluirlo en la parte superior de su código (sin indicar la ruta de acceso). Usted hace que el uso de la directiva de preprocesamiento #include con el nombre del archivo de cabecera solo en paréntesis angulares. ¿Có